My quarter-of-a-Gap-Year in India

I am going to India in May for three months. I will start in Delhi and plan to travel around as much as I can, and hopefully find something worthwhile to do. I have written to a number of charities - 3 so far, so please let me know if you know of any organisation who might like me to work for them. And any other advice will be welcome, except if you are going to say that May is the worst possible time to go to India - because I know that. I don't plan to take my best shoes.

Doesn't your Mother live with you? you may ask... Yes she does and my priority now is to get care set up for her.  This week I send off for my visa, the following week I book the flight. Things are under way...  it's so exciting.

The trip will provide rich pickings for this blog - I will keep you up to date during this planning stage.. Helpful hints are welcome.
